Transaction ec3911bd7a5b496694a0a74809ca331f7593e7cc897ddc904f42915054de26bb
1 Input
1 Output
-
ec3911bd7a5b496694a0a74809ca331f7593e7cc897ddc904f42915054de26bb:0
- value
- 4615672
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 11e6c168f89a724fc24c0cc875e9febe26c4e95a OP_EQUAL
- address
- 33KfqyiRE43KaFg9UCxon4GvErXdbCKAfX